Struct PurgeInstanceFilter 

Source
pub struct PurgeInstanceFilter {
    pub created_time_from: Option<DateTime<Utc>>,
    pub created_time_to: Option<DateTime<Utc>>,
    pub runtime_status: Vec<OrchestrationStatus>,
}
Expand description

Filter criteria for bulk-purging orchestration instances.

Build using the provided builder methods, then pass to TaskHubGrpcClient::purge_orchestrations_by_filter.

An empty filter matches all instances. Narrow the scope with with_created_time_from, with_created_time_to, and with_runtime_status.

§Examples

use dapr_durabletask::api::{OrchestrationStatus, PurgeInstanceFilter};

let filter = PurgeInstanceFilter::new()
    .with_created_time_from(chrono::Utc::now() - chrono::Duration::hours(24))
    .with_runtime_status([OrchestrationStatus::Completed, OrchestrationStatus::Failed]);

Fields§

§created_time_from: Option<DateTime<Utc>>

Only purge instances created at or after this time.

§created_time_to: Option<DateTime<Utc>>

Only purge instances created before or at this time.

§runtime_status: Vec<OrchestrationStatus>

Only purge instances whose runtime status is in this list. An empty list matches all statuses.

Implementations§

Source§

impl PurgeInstanceFilter

Source

pub fn new() -> Self

Create an empty filter that matches all instances.

Source

pub fn with_created_time_from(self, from: DateTime<Utc>) -> Self

Only purge instances created at or after the given time.

Source

pub fn with_created_time_to(self, to: DateTime<Utc>) -> Self

Only purge instances created before or at the given time.

Source

pub fn with_runtime_status( self, statuses: impl IntoIterator<Item = OrchestrationStatus>, ) -> Self

Only purge instances whose runtime status is in the provided list.
